 Consequence Modeling





 
 
Consequence modeling measures the distance a hazardous material  may travel in the event of a release. . While some software is intended for use with continuous releases, or with an ongoing process, the software listed below is intended for accidental releases.
 
ALOHA/CAMEO Developed by EPA and NOAA, CAMEO's ALOHA is an atmospheric dispersion model used for evaluating releases of hazardous chemical vapors. ALOHA allows the user to estimate the downwind dispersion of a chemical cloud based on the toxicological/physical characteristics of the released chemical, atmospheric conditions, and specific circumstances of the release. Graphical outputs include a "cloud footprint" that can be plotted on maps with MARPLOT to display the location of other facilities storing hazardous materials and vulnerable locations, such as hospitals and schools.
